Development of 23 maize hybrids with high yield potential and competitive agronomic characteristics for the highlands, mid-altitudes and lowlands of Mexico.
The selection of these 23 hybrids was based on the results of hybrids evaluation trials established in different localities of Mexico in the 2020 spring-summer season (such trials were established from four to seven localities).
